缓存控制之间的区别是:最大年龄=0和没有缓存?

缓存控制之间的区别是:最大年龄=0和没有缓存?

标头Cache-Control: max-age=0意味着内容被认为是过时的(必须立即重新获取),这实际上与Cache-Control: no-cache.


大话西游666
浏览 482回答 3
3回答

忽然笑

最大年龄=0这相当于单击刷新,这意味着,给我最新的副本,除非我已经有最新的副本。无缓存这就够了换档在单击Refresh时,这意味着,无论什么情况,只要重新做所有事情就行了。

白衣非少年

现在有个老问题了,但是如果其他人像我一样通过搜索发现了这个问题,那么IE9将在使用“后退”和“前进”按钮时使用它来配置资源的行为。什么时候最大年龄=0使用时,浏览器将在后/向前按下查看资源时使用最后一个版本。如果无缓存则资源将被重新获取。有关IE9缓存的更多详细信息,请参见MSDN缓存博客文章.
打开App,查看更多内容
随时随地看视频慕课网APP